The prices of several food commodities in Bali today are observed to be higher compared to yesterday.
Citing data from the National Food Agency (Bapanas) food price panel on Sunday (16/6/2024) at 16.37 WIB, out of 20 commodities, 7 commodities increased in price and 4 commodities decreased.
Commodities that increased in price are packaged simple cooking oil, milkfish, chicken eggs, bulk wheat flour, and red chilies.
Meanwhile, the prices of several commodities such as medium rice, garlic bulbs, red chilies, and shallots decreased compared to yesterday's prices.
Red chilies saw the highest price increase, jumping Rp1,550 (3.41%) to Rp47,040 per kg. Red chilies experienced the sharpest price drop, falling Rp1,050 (3.11%) to Rp32,700 per kg.
The following is a complete list of the prices of 20 food commodities in Bali according to Bapanas on June 16, 2024, at 16.37 WIB.
1. Pure Beef: Rp117,430 per kg (unchanged)
2. Red Chilies: Rp47,040 per kg (up 3.41%)
3. Chicken Meat: Rp40,270 per kg (up 0.57%)
4. Mackerel: Rp38,670 per kg (unchanged)
5. Milkfish: Rp38,390 per kg (up 1.94%)
6. Garlic Bulbs: Rp36,210 per kg (down 0.96%)
7. Shallots: Rp33,180 per kg (down 1.66%)
8. Red Chilies (Rawit): Rp32,700 per kg (down 3.11%)
9. Skipjack Tuna: Rp27,900 per kg (unchanged)
10. Chicken Eggs: Rp27,810 per kg (up 0.25%)
11. Packaged Simple Cooking Oil: Rp17,860 per liter (up 0.45%)
12. Granulated Sugar: Rp17,460 per kg (unchanged)
13. Bulk Cooking Oil: Rp15,990 per liter (up 1.98%)
14. Premium Rice: Rp15,110 per kg (unchanged)
15. Medium Rice: Rp13,350 per kg (down 0.22%)
16. Packaged Wheat Flour (non-bulk): Rp12,110 per kg (unchanged)
17. Fine Iodized Salt: Rp11,730 per kg (unchanged)
18. Dry Soybean Seeds (Import): Rp11,440 per kg (unchanged)
19. Bulk Wheat Flour: Rp10,560 per kg (up 0.38%)
20. Corn (Farmer Level): Rp5,510 per kg (unchanged)
